The power to utilize magic involving the dead, death-force and/or souls. Form of Magic and Dark Arts. Utilized by Necromancers. Magical variation of Death-Force Manipulation. Opposite to Animancy. Not to be confused with Death-Force Arts.

Also Called

  • Black-Animancy/Dark-Animancy
  • Death/Death-Related Commands/Spells
  • Necro/Undeath Magic

Capabilities

The users either have magical abilities or have powers that revolve around manipulating the dead, death, the death-force and/or souls for good (i.e., resurrecting the dead), evil (in various ways), or neither. They can also communicate with the deceased – either by summoning their spirit as an apparition or raising them bodily – for the purpose of divination, imparting the means to foretell future events or discover hidden knowledge. This is most frequently depicted as being able to resurrect the dead to varying to degrees, from shambling corpses to conscious zombies to even complete Resurrection. More powerful users and directly convert the living into the undead, allowing them to bypass conventional durability by turning an opponent into a mindless zombie at the user's control.

Many practitioners find a way to cheat death one way or another, whether by becoming some form of undead creature or by bypassing their own ability to die.
